Problem
Existing driving systems for automated guidance and maneuvering of motor vehicles often lead to driver discomfort due to the need to evaluate and accept offers for recorded driving maneuvers while driving manually.
Innovation Solution
A driving system that allows drivers to record and store driving maneuvers, which can then be executed automatically when the vehicle reaches a predefined activation point or region, adhering closely to the recorded trajectory while ensuring safety and comfort.

A driving system for automated maneuvering of a motor vehicle based on a recorded driving maneuver of the motor vehicle is provided. The driving system is configured to detect that a recorded driving maneuver is available at a destination of a travel of the motor vehicle, which destination is specified by a user. In response thereto, the driving system is further configured to cause the motor vehicle to be maneuvered in an automated manner at the destination based on the recorded driving maneuver.
